在热扩散柱中形成原细胞样囊泡
Itay Budin1, Raphael J Bruckner, Jack W Szostak
1Department of Molecular and Cellular Biology, Harvard University, Cambridge, Massachusetts 02138, USA.
Journal of the American Chemical Society
|July 16, 2009
概括
原始细胞膜可能会自发形成. 微毛细管中的热扩散缩了油酸,使囊泡能够从稀释溶液中自组装,这表明了早期生命起源的途径.

Vesicular Tubular Clusters
After budding out from the ER membrane, some COPII vesicles lose their coat and fuse with one another to form larger vesicles and interconnected tubules called vesicular tubular clusters or VTCs. These clusters constitute a compartment at the ER-Golgi interface known as ERGIC (Endoplasmic Reticulum Golgi Intermediate Compartment). The ERGIC is a mobile membrane-bound cargo transport system that sorts proteins secreted from ER and delivers them to the Golgi.

Diffusion on Chromatography Columns
In column chromatography, when an analyte is introduced as a narrow band at the top of the column, the solutes begin to separate and broaden, developing a Gaussian profile. This broadening occurs due to various factors, such as longitudinal diffusion.

Overview of Secretory Vesicles
Secretory vesicles, also known as dense core vesicles (DCVs), are membrane-bound vesicles that transport secretory proteins, such as hormones or neurotransmitters. Regulated secretory vesicles transport proteins from the trans-Golgi network to the exterior of the cell. Proteins present in regulated secretory vesicles are required to be rapidly exocytosed in large amounts upon a specific stimulus.
